Sampling Conditions
If the engine is equipped with a sampling port, the engine should be running at operating temperature when the sample is obtained.If the engine is not equipped with a sampling port, the coolant should be warm.Use the following guidelines for proper sampling of the coolant:
Complete the information on the label for the sampling bottle before you begin to take the samples.
Keep the unused sampling bottles stored in plastic bags.
Obtain coolant samples directly from the coolant sample port. You should not obtain the samples from any other location.
Keep the lids on empty sampling bottles until you are ready to collect the sample.
Place the sample in the mailing tube immediately after obtaining the sample in order to avoid contamination.
Never collect samples from expansion bottles.
Never collect samples from the drain for a system.Timing of the Sampling

(1) The Level 2 Coolant Analysis should be performed sooner if a problem is suspected or identified.Note: Check the SCA (Supplemental Coolant Additive) of the conventional coolant at every oil change or at every 250 hours. Perform this check at the interval that occurs first.Obtain the sample of the coolant as close as possible to the recommended sampling interval. In order to receive the full effect of S O S analysis, establish a consistent trend of data. In order to establish a pertinent history of data, perform consistent samplings that are evenly spaced. Supplies for collecting samples can be obtained from your Cat dealer.
Always use a designated pump for oil sampling, and use a separate designated pump for coolant sampling. Using the same pump for both types of samples may contaminate the samples that are being drawn. This contaminate may cause a false analysis and an incorrect interpretation that could lead to concerns by both dealers and customers.
Submit the sample for Level 1 analysis.Note: Level 1 results may indicate a need for Level 2 Analysis.
